Transaction d8ecaab4c6022a4457909e45e5b6469b2c7ee68313b871e6729c7d787778d79a
1 Input
1 Output
-
d8ecaab4c6022a4457909e45e5b6469b2c7ee68313b871e6729c7d787778d79a:0
- value
- 749364
- script pubkey
- OP_0 OP_PUSHBYTES_20 24f40dce1767501d7fe19441b6132fb8dbcd3f23
- address
- bc1qyn6qmnshvagp6llpj3qmvye0hrdu60erfeaqge